REMINDER TO ALL MBAM MEMBERS ON THE CURRENT COVID-19 SITUATION

In light of the current Coronavirus Disease 2019 (COVID-19) pandemic situation, MBAM would like to urge and remind all MBAM members (including but not limited to your subcontractors and suppliers) to take few of the following preventive measures:

  1. If you or your employee (including your foreign workers) are experiencing related symptoms such as fever, cough and difficulty in breathing, or came across any close contact with infected patient, or have been to affected countries, we highly recommend that you do seek for medical consultation or practice self-quarantine.
  2. If you or your employee (including your foreign workers) have participated in mass gatherings such as the Sri Petaling Tabligh Gathering on 28th February – 3rd March 2020, please identify them and immediately contact the National Crisis Preparedness and Response Centre (CPRC) or the District Health Office near you, as per circulated by the Malaysian Ministry of Health (MOH). Please refer to MOH’s website at http://www.moh.gov.my/ for more information.
  3. Practice good hygiene at all times especially on construction sites. Employers are suggested to provide hand sanitizer and face masks to workers. Regular temperature check before work is highly recommended.

We need to do our part to protect our industry and country. Members are advised to follow the latest developments related to COVID-19 while adhere to the latest guidance of Government and public health officials from time to time.
